Inclusion criteria

Inclusion criteria: 1. Invasively ventilated children (term neonate to 16 years) 2. Expected to stay >48 hours in PICU 3. Receiving some form of nutrition (enteral and/or parenteral) 4. Parents consent to the study 5. Normal neurologically 6. Of walking age 7. Independently ambulatory pre-admission 8. No previous PICU admission within the last 5 years 9. No known neuromuscular disease

Design outcomes

Primary

MeasureTime frame
1. PICU muscle wasting assessed using ultrasound at days 1, 3, 5, 7 and 10 of PICU stay, hospital discharge and 3 months 2. Protein intake during critical illness assessed using nitrogen balance (g/day) from admission to PICU discharge

Secondary

MeasureTime frame
1. Energy intake during critical illness assessed using electronic hospital records from admission to PICU discharge 2. Nitrogen balance during critical illness assessed using routine dietician calculations from admission to PICU discharge 3. Inflammatory markers (CRP) that relate to the severity of illness, measured using routinely collected blood tests over the PICU stay 4. Muscle wasting and function changes assessed using ultrasound during PICU admission and from PICU discharge to 3 months after PICU discharge 5. Risk factors for PICU-muscle wasting assessed using history and electronic hospital records during PICU stay 6. Length of ventilation, PICU length of stay, and hospital length of stay assessed using electronic hospital records at PICU and hospital discharge 7. Functional physical state (FSS) assessed using FSS score at PICU and hospital discharge and at 3 months 8. Muscle function recovery assessed using Bayley’s motor score, MFM 20 or MFM 32 at PICU and hospital discharge and at 3 months 9. Quality of life assessed using PedsQL at 3 months after PICU discharge
